Word: Rehash
Speech Type: Verb
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
riːˈhaʃ
Dialects: British English
Definition:
reuse (old ideas or material) without significant change or improvement
Short Definition:reuse old ideas or material without significant change or improvement
Examples:- he endlessly rehashes songs from his American era
Word: Rehash
Speech Type: Noun
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
ˈriːhaʃ
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a reuse of old ideas or material without significant change or improvement
Short Definition:reuse of old ideas or material
Examples:- the spring show was a rehash of the summer show from the previous year
